

POSITION OVERVIEW
The NI SystemLink R&D software team is seeking to hire a software engineer with experience developing scalable, production-ready web applications and web services. The SystemLink software team develops cloud-native, SaaS enterprise applications for fast-paced, high-growth industries across semiconductor, electronics, automotive, and aerospace/defense markets.
KEY RESPONSIBILITIES
? Deliver high-quality implementation and testing of feature sets for new and existing products
? Develop full-stack, production-ready applications in a collaborative team environment
? Collaborate with Technical Product Managers and Technical Leads to translate customer requirements into high-level design proposals
? Divide large, complex projects into manageable tasks; help develop timelines and milestones
? Review design documents and changesets for accuracy, quality, and maintainability
? Identify technical project risks and propose mitigations and contingencies
? Propose and participate in efforts to continuously improve how the team works
? Contribute to CI/CD infrastructure and processes to improve quality and efficiency
? Continually grow knowledge of customers, product line, and underlying technologies
? Influence growth throughout the organization via mentorship and knowledge sharing
? Network and collaborate with peers in a variety of functions (engineers, designers, IT specialists, technical writers, etc.) across a globalized workforce
? Provide technical expertise, support and training to technical support engineers, applications / systems engineers customers and other product users
? Maintain continuous product uptime by monitoring health metrics and resolving alarms
DEMONSTRATED ABILITY TO:
? Rapidly learn and establish expertise in new products, technologies, and tooling
? Translate user requirements into technical design and implementation tasks
? Follow best practices and coding conventions with a continual focus on improvement
? Root cause complex problems with effective debugging and propose solutions
? Take ownership of objectives/tasks and drive to completion
? Communicate (verbal and written) effectively on technical and non-technical topics to peers and up to stakeholders
? Be a self-starter with strong work ethic and a drive to excel